Category: None Group: None Status: Open Resolution: None Priority: 5 Private: No Submitted By: Adam Olsen (rhamphoryncus) Assigned to: Nobody/Anonymous (nobody) Summary: htonl, ntohl don't handle negative longs Initial Comment: >>> htonl(-5) -67108865 >>> htonl(-5L) Traceback (most recent call last): File "<stdin>", line 1, in ? OverflowError: can't convert negative value to unsigned long It works fine in 2.1 and 2.2, but fails in 2.3, 2.4, 2.5. htons, ntohs do not appear to have the bug, but I'm not 100% sure. ---------------------------------------------------------------------- >Comment By: Adam Olsen (rhamphoryncus) Date: 2006-12-28 14:37 Message: Logged In: YES user_id=12364 Originator: YES I forgot to mention it, but the only reason htonl should get passed a negative number is that it (and possibly struct?) produce a negative number. Changing them to always produce positive numbers may be an alternative solution. Or we may want to do both, always producing positive while also accepting negative. ---------------------------------------------------------------------- Comment By: Mark Roberts (mark-roberts) Date: 2006-12-26 02:24 Message: Logged In: YES user_id=1591633 Originator: NO >From man page for htonl and friends: #include <arpa/inet.h> uint32_t htonl(uint32_t hostlong); uint16_t htons(uint16_t hostshort); uint32_t ntohl(uint32_t netlong); uint16_t ntohs(uint16_t netshort); Python does call these underlying functions in Modules/socketmodule.c. The problem comes from that PyLong_AsUnsignedLong() called in socket_htonl() specifically checks to see that the value cannot be less than 0.
